Bianca Del Rio: The Queen of Sassy Comedy and Unapologetic Humor

A Brief Introduction to the Drag Queen Extraordinaire

Bianca Del Rio is a household name, synonymous with witty humor, sharp tongue, and unapologetic comedy. This American drag queen, comedian, actor, and costume designer rose to fame after winning the sixth season of RuPaul's Drag Race, leaving a lasting impact on the world of entertainment.

The Early Life of a Comedy Genius

Born Roy R. Haylock on June 27, 1975, in Gretna, Louisiana, Bianca Del Rio's journey to stardom was far from conventional. With a rich cultural heritage, courtesy of his Cuban mother and Honduran father, Haylock was the fourth of five siblings. His love for acting and costume design began to take shape at West Jefferson High School, where he was actively involved in school plays.

From New Orleans to New York City: The Rise of Bianca Del Rio

After high school, Haylock moved to New York City, where he worked at Bloomingdale's for a brief period. However, it was his return to Louisiana that marked the beginning of his career as a costume designer. His big break came in 1993, when he won a Big Easy Entertainment Award for Best Costume Design at the tender age of 17. This recognition paved the way for his future nominations, eventually winning six awards for his outstanding work in costume design.

The Birth of Bianca Del Rio: A Drag Queen Like No Other

In 1996, Haylock's life took a dramatic turn when he started performing as a drag artist in the play Pageant. This marked the beginning of Bianca Del Rio's reign as a drag queen. With her quick wit, sharp tongue, and unapologetic humor, Del Rio went on to win the New Orleans Gay Entertainer of the Year award three times. Her success in the Big Easy eventually led her to become a cogrand marshal for Southern Decadence XXIX in 2001, alongside Pat Estelle Ritter and Rick Thomas.

RuPaul's Drag Race and Beyond

Del Rio's participation in RuPaul's Drag Race Season 6 catapulted her to international fame. Her sharp humor, clever antics, and impeccable style won her the crown, making her a fan favorite. Post-Drag Race, Del Rio has written and toured several standup shows, including "It's Jester Joke" in 2019, which made her the first drag queen to headline at Wembley Arena. She has also hosted various international tours, most notably Werq the World.

Literary Ventures and Philanthropy

In 2018, Del Rio published her first book, "Blame It On Bianca Del Rio: The Expert On Nothing With An Opinion On Everything." This humorous guide to life showcases her unique perspective and wit. Apart from her literary pursuits, Del Rio has been involved in various charity events, using her platform to raise awareness and funds for the LGBTQ+ community.
